Pufferfish.
How the hell do you fight these waves of 5-8 pufferfish? They take an awful lot of shots, and they blow away all your hp.. and you have to fight several waves at times.. Honestly decent game, but these guys are literal brick wall run killers

If you play the game a bit longer you will notice that there is only a certain number of possible enemy groups and when you see the first long line of exploding fish you know there will be more. They come from alternating sides of the ship, 8 waves should be the maximum iirc.

To answer the question how to beat them: Kill any one of them. Aim for one, it will blow up and take all of the others with it. If your weapons are too weak to kill a puffer fish before it is so close that it damages your ship your run was probably going to fail anyways.
Acknowledge that these fish are the single most dangerous enemy in this kind of encounter and get ready to deal with them. Put a cannon on both sides of the boat or, if you are playing solo, switch the cannon to the other side of the boat and load it up as soon as the first fish explodes.

They may have gotten you once or twice now and I understand that you are angry to have lost in this way but I don't think you will be killed by them again.
I like those waves, to be honest, they represent a large number of enemies that you can kill very quickly which, given the right items, can net you a lot of gold.

Oh, and, get ready to encounter these fish but with a bit more health again during the final encounter of your run!

Pufferfish aren't actually hard to beat once you know how, however this is also the basic strategy for winning the game so SPOILER ALERT -


you need to play as aggressive as possible - collect as many trinkets/artifacts/ammo as possible, especially trinkets cause they don't take up space and especially in forgotten waters cause it's the easiest. don't rush to the boss, pass through as many tiles as you can. the only exception is if you're really low on some specific resource, then collect that instead. by the time you reach pufferfish (and any other enemy for that matter) you will almost surely have enough fire power to wipe most of them out before they hurt you. of course, you still need to shoot at them yourself, don't wait for the sentries to do it.
If some of them still manage to get close, you can knock them back with the paddle. that doesn't always work and it takes some sense of timing, practice it a bit and you will get it.
